 Back in March Stanford anthropologist T.M. Luhrmann wrote an interesting op-ed in the New York Times focusing on the politics of evangelicals but relevant to Orthodox Jews too:

It’s election season and once again Democrats are flummoxed by evangelical voters.… That’s because evangelicals and secular liberals … think about life — and therefore politics — in such utterly different ways.

If you want to understand how evangelicals conceive of their political life you need to understand how they think about G-d.… What someone believes is important to these Christians but what really matters is becoming a better person. As I listened in church and participated in prayer groups I saw that when people prayed they imagined themselves in conversation with G-d.… They … try to become the person they would be if they were always aware of being in G-d’s presence even when the kids fuss and the train runs late.…

This completely changes the way someone thinks about politics.
